vbalistbox(VBA中如何使用ListBox控件呢)
无论是vbalistbox还是VBA中如何使用ListBox控件呢,它们都是当前热门话题。如果你对它们感到好奇,那么请跟随小编的脚步,一起来揭开它们的秘密吧!
excel vba 窗体中listbox用法
1、首先需要打开Excel的表格,如图所示,点击下面的文件1,鼠标右键单击选择查看代码。
2、然后就是进入代码页面,可以看到页面上现在的代码。
3、然后接下来就是需要用listbox用法,如图所示,输入Sheet1.Cells(1, 3)= Sheet1.Cells(1, 1)+ Sheet1.Cells(1, 2),回车。
4、最后,再返回到页面上,如图所示,双击一下表格就可以看到数字了,listbox用法成功。
VBA中如何使用ListBox控件呢
ListBox控件显示项目列表,从其中可以选择一项或多项。如果项目总数超过了可显示的项目数,就自动在 ListBox控件上添加滚动条。
如果未选定项目,则 ListIndex属性值是-1。列表的第一项是 ListIndex 0,ListCount属性值总是比最大的 ListIndex值大 1。
语法
ListBox
说明
使用 AddItem或者 RemoveItem方法可以添加或者删除 ListBox控件中的项目。对 List、ListCount和 ListIndex属性进行设置就可以访问 ListBox中的项目。也可以在设计时使用 List属性在列表中增加项目。
实例
DimEntry,I,Msg'声明变量。
Msg="ChooseOKtoadd100itemstoyourlistbox."
MsgBoxMsg'显示信息。
ForI=1To100'计数值从1到100。
Entry="Entry"&I'创建输入项。
List1.AddItemEntry'添加该输入项。
NextI
Msg="ChooseOKtoremoveeveryotherentry."
MsgBoxMsg'显示信息。
ForI=1To50'确定如何
List1.RemoveItemI'每隔一项
NextI'删除。
Msg="ChooseOKtoremoveallitemsfromthelistbox."
MsgBoxMsg'显示信息。
List1.Clear'清除列表框。
vbalistbox控件字体为红色
需要用到MFC的列表控件,列表控件中需要动态插入产品不同的测试状态,产品的不同状态下的测试结果分为PASS和FAIL两种情况,这两种测试结果插入的状态字符串颜色分别呈现为绿色和红色。并且双击状态Item,绘制出对应状态下的测试结果曲线。
1、ListBox无法直接设置字体颜色,因此需要自己实现对字体重绘功能。创建一个继承ListBox的类CColorListBox,重写ListBox中以下虚函数virtualvoidDrawItem(LPDRAWITEMSTRUCTlpDrawItemStruct);virtualvoidMeasureItem(LPMEASUREITEMSTRUCTlpMeasureItemStruct);2以及重载函数。
vba设置listbox框表头名称
AddItem
向列表框添加新项目,其格式为:
ListBox控件名.AddItem<项目>[,<索引值>]
其中:
<项目>为字符串表达式,表示添加到列表框中的新项目。
<索引值>为数值表达式,指定在列表框中插入新项目的位置。若为0,则插入到第一个项目位置;若缺省且Sorted属性为False,则插入到最后一个项目位置;
若缺省且Sorted属性为True,则插入到合适的排序位置。
RemoveItem
从列表框中删除项目,其格式为:
ListBox控件名.RemoveItem<索引值>
好了,本文到此结束,如果可以帮助到大家,还望关注本站哦!